GD++* Illustrations: B/w line drawn map at front.* Pages: 279 pp. text.* Product Description:- First in the Kurt Wallander series. It was a senselessly violent crime: on a cold night in a remote Swedish farmhouse an elderly farmer is bludgeoned to death, and his wife is left to die with a noose around her neck. And as if this didn't present enough problems for the Ystad police Inspector Kurt Wallander, the dying woman's last word is foreign, leaving the police the one tangible clue they have - and in the process, the match that could inflame Sweden's already smoldering anti-immigrant sentiments.* This is an acceptable reading copy of the 1st./3rd. without any missing pages or annotation.*
